Ditch Digging in Salt Lake City, UT

Ditch digging services involve the excavation of narrow or deep trenches in residential properties to support various installation and repair projects. Common uses include laying utility lines such as water, gas, or electrical cables, installing drainage systems, or preparing for foundation work.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of the excavation, the depth and width of the trenches, and how the work will be coordinated with existing landscaping or structures to ensure minimal disruption.

Before requesting ditch digging services, homeowners should consider factors such as the location of underground utilities, property boundaries, and access points for equipment. It’s also helpful to plan for any necessary permits or approvals from local authorities. Clarifying these details can help ensure the project proceeds smoothly and meets the specific needs of the property.

Project Types

Common Ditch Digging Jobs

Drainage Installation - Installing new drain lines to prevent water pooling and manage runoff effectively.

Utility Line Digging - Creating trenches for water, gas, or electrical lines to ensure proper underground connections.

Foundation Drainage - Installing drainage systems around foundations to reduce basement moisture issues.

Landscape Drainage - Installing French drains and surface drains to protect lawns and gardens from excess water.

Sewer Line Replacement - Replacing or repairing damaged sewer lines to maintain proper waste flow.

Irrigation System Installation - Digging trenches for sprinkler and irrigation systems to promote healthy landscaping.

FAQ

Ditch Digging Questions

What types of projects require ditch digging? Ditch digging is often needed for drainage systems, irrigation, utility lines, or landscape grading on residential properties.

Is ditch digging suitable for small or large properties? Ditch digging can be performed on both small and large properties, depending on the scope of the project and site conditions.

What should property owners consider before starting ditch digging? It's important to assess underground utilities, soil type, and property layout to ensure safe and effective excavation.

How does ditch digging impact property drainage? Properly installed ditches help direct water flow away from structures, reducing the risk of flooding and water damage.
